Former prime minister Nawaz Sharif, who recently returned to Pakistan after four years in exile, is likely to visit Sindh, KP and Balochistan province to mobilse his party ahead of polls. Sources privy to the matter told the media that the PML-N supremo is likely to visit cities in Sindh, KP and Balochistan at the end of this month.
